What’s changed
🚀 Enhancements
- Replace async_timeout with asyncio.timeout frenck (841)
🧰 Maintenance
- Update development toolchain frenck (829)
- Add Python 3.12 to CI frenck (842)
⬆️ Dependency updates
- ⬆️ Update github/codeql-action action to v2.22.4 renovate (814)
- ⬆️ Update release-drafter/release-drafter action to v5.25.0 renovate (815)
- ⬆️ Lock file maintenance renovate (816)
- ⬆️ Update dependency black to v23.10.1 renovate (818)
- ⬆️ Update actions/setup-node digest to 1a4442c renovate (817)
- ⬆️ Update dependency pylint to v3.0.2 renovate (819)
- ⬆️ Update dependency pytest to v7.4.3 renovate (820)
- ⬆️ Update dependency ruff to v0.1.2 renovate (821)
- ⬆️ Update dependency node to v20.9.0 renovate (822)
- ⬆️ Update dependency ruff to v0.1.3 renovate (823)
- ⬆️ Update actions/setup-node action to v4 renovate (824)
- ⬆️ Update github/codeql-action action to v2.22.5 renovate (825)
- ⬆️ Lock file maintenance renovate (826)
- ⬆️ Update dependency ruff to v0.1.4 renovate (827)
- ⬆️ Lock file maintenance renovate (828)
- ⬆️ Update dependency ruff to v0.1.5 renovate (830)
- ⬆️ Update dependency yamllint to v1.33.0 renovate (831)
- ⬆️ Update dependency mypy to v1.7.0 renovate (832)
- ⬆️ Update dependency prettier to v3.1.0 renovate (833)
- ⬆️ Update github/codeql-action action to v2.22.6 renovate (835)
- ⬆️ Update dessant/lock-threads action to v5 renovate (834)
- ⬆️ Update dependency safety to v2.4.0b2 renovate (836)
- ⬆️ Update github/codeql-action action to v2.22.7 renovate (837)
- ⬆️ Update dependency ruff to v0.1.6 renovate (838)
- ⬆️ Update dependency aiohttp to v3.9.0 renovate (839)
- ⬆️ Lock file maintenance renovate (840)